New York Style Pizza Crust Recipe
A bread-machine version of New York style pizza crust made using the dough cycle.
Ingredients
| 2/3 cup | 160 ml | warm water |
| 1/2 teaspoon | 2.5 ml | salt |
| 2 1/4 cups | 540 ml | all-purpose flour |
| 1 teaspoon | 5 ml | sugar |
| 2 teaspoons | 10 ml | active dry yeast |
| 1 tablespoon | 15 ml | cornmeal - optional |
Instructions
Measure carefully, placing all ingredients except cornmeal in the bread machine pan in the order specified by the owner's manual. Program the dough cycle setting; press start. Remove the dough from the bread machine pan; let rest for 2 to 3 minutes.
Gently pat and stretch the dough from the edges until the dough seems like it won't stretch anymore. Let rest 2 to 3 minutes more. Continue patting and stretching until the dough is 12 to 14 inches in diameter. Spray a 12 to 14-inch pizza pan with cooking spray; sprinkle with cornmeal, if desired. Press the dough into the pan.
Preheat the oven to 450°F. Follow the topping and baking instructions for individual recipes, baking pizza on the lower rack of the oven.
